The Freedom Bus is Back on the Road: Join the 2020 Freedom Ride!
In April 2020, the Freedom Bus will return to the streets! Since 2011, we have invited friends and comrades from around the world to join us in Palestine for the annual Freedom Ride, an initiative organized by The Freedom Theatre in partnership with popular struggle committees across Occupied Palestine. After a three-year break, we are once again calling on you to help bring cultural resistance back to the streets!
The 2020 Freedom Ride will gather artists and activists from diverse movements around the world. Palestinians and international participants will come together to stand in defiance of oppression, share experiences and ideas, build alliances, and engage in discussions on topics such as the Boycott, Divestment and Sanctions (BDS) movement, the role of international civil society, and resistance through art. Participants will exchange knowledge through storytelling, teach-ins, community work, interactive theatre, and other cultural actions in some of the key areas of oppression and resistance within Occupied Palestine.
ITINERARY
The Freedom Ride begins in Jenin on 11 April, traveling next to the Jordan Valley for several days, then moving on to Hebron and the South Hebron Hills, and concluding in Bethlehem on 20 April. A more detailed itinerary will be provided to participants closer to the event.
CONDITIONS
The Freedom Ride focuses on financially impoverished communities, and living conditions during the ride will be very simple. Some host communities lack basic services, including electricity, telephone lines, running water, sewage systems, schools, and clinics. Accommodation will be in shared rooms or communal spaces, with shower facilities not always available, and outdoor toilets in some locations.
This ride requires a high tolerance level; participants should be prepared for challenging situations and willing to approach them calmly and supportively. In return, you will gain a unique, first-hand experience of life in Occupied Palestine and take an active part in the movement for freedom and justice.
